Emerging Technologies Reshaping Space Missions

Recent advancements in propulsion systems, materials science, and artificial intelligence have dramatically lowered the costs and increased the scope of space missions. Reusable launch vehicles pioneered by companies like SpaceX and Blue Origin exemplify a paradigm shift, making space more accessible than ever before. This democratization of space has pivotal implications for scientific research, commercial enterprise, and geopolitical influence.

Comparative Data on Launch Costs and Capabilities (2023)
Platform Cost per Launch (USD) Payload Capacity (kg) Reusability
Falcon 9 $62 million 22,800 Yes
SLS (NASA) $2 billion (est.) 96,000 No
Starship (SpaceX) Projected $10 million 100,000+ Yes

The evolution of launch systems is not merely a matter of economics but also one of strategic importance. As access to space becomes increasingly economical, new missions—ranging from asteroid mining to interplanetary travel—are entering the realm of possibility.
